    What you might find if you study up on Queen and Schatt & Morgan knives is the quality is equal and often surpasses GEC. The choices and models have more models that appear and are just as quickly bought as GEC knives. The difference is; you to have hunt them like everyone else and not wait around for the next knife drop from GEC. Remember how long Queen and Schatt & Morgan have made knives before GEC was even in business. So; it easy to understand the difference; there many more multi-blade models to choose from. Most have a high polish finish and models are not bought and resold for inflated prices immediately. It is easy to see GEC models are often copies of Queen Models with a few changes. The Key Stone shield represents Pennsylvania the Key Stone state. One reason; I like them is because I lived in Pennsylvania all my life. Another is; you are collecting history not just another next new model. The founder of GEC didn’t wake up and understand how to make knives; he learned from someone else.
